This is a formal petition to the Wachesaw Plantation East Board of Directors to schedule an emergency meeting with members of the WPE Community to discuss the denial of amenities that has been initiated by the Board, specifically access to the Pool and Fitness Center.

The Community has requested over multiple mediums (email to First Services, NextDoor App, Facebook page, etc) to hold this meeting but the board has not responded and continue to unilaterally make decisions that impact the entire community. This poses direct risks to the community since the HOA is in Breach of Contract and is open to lawsuits from the community who are not being provided with the Amenities they purchased when buying real estate in WPE.

This petition requests a properly advertised meeting (as per the WPE ByLaws document) with the Board, FirstServices and our community Lawyer where the public can propose ideas, ask questions, and work with the Board to help them meet their responsibility in providing the aforementioned amenities.

Thank you for your consideration signing this petition.

Update: Board initially said they were going to hold a meeting but then backed out of the meeting (see email from FirstServices dated July 1st). We would need 25% of the community to sign in order to force a special meeting according to our ByLaws
